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 21.12.2016, 01:38   #1
Meksvinz
 
Регистрация: 05.11.2016
Сообщений: 7
Вопрос C/C++.Циклический сдвиг матрицы с помощью файловых потоков

Получил на лабораторной работе задание на файловые потоки. Вроде и понимаю что надо сделать, но не могу понять с помощью чего и вообще с какой стороны к этому делу подступиться. Помогите хотяб начать. Использовать можно только потоки типа : fopen, fclose и тд. Заранее спасибо!
Изображения
Тип файла: jpg Лаба, потоки В14.jpg (33.2 Кб, 33 просмотров)

Последний раз редактировалось Meksvinz; 21.12.2016 в 09:33. Причина: Ошибка в формулировке задачи
Meksvinz вне форума Ответить с цитированием
Старый 21.12.2016, 08:19   #2
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,833
По умолчанию

Определитесь сначала, что вам нужно. В С нет файловых потоков стандартных, iostream завезли в С++
p51x вне форума Ответить с цитированием
Старый 21.12.2016, 09:33   #3
Meksvinz
 
Регистрация: 05.11.2016
Сообщений: 7
По умолчанию

Цитата:
Сообщение от p51x Посмотреть сообщение
Определитесь сначала, что вам нужно. В С нет файловых потоков стандартных, iostream завезли в С++
Хм. Значит я что-то перепутал. Имелось ввиду, что можно использовать только потоки типа (fopen и fclose...), а не потоки (ofstream & ifstream).
Meksvinz вне форума Ответить с цитированием
Старый 21.12.2016, 10:29   #4
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,833
По умолчанию

Еще раз fopen не поток, это просто функция. Фиг с этим... Что вы от файлов то хотите в этой задаче?

В чем проблема с задачей? Тупо в лоб: рассматриваем матрицу по столбцам и получаем на каждом шаге одномерный массив, который надо циклически сдвинуть.
p51x вне форума Ответить с цитированием
Старый 21.12.2016, 10:45   #5
eoln
Старожил
 
Аватар для eoln
 
Регистрация: 26.04.2008
Сообщений: 2,645
По умолчанию

Наверное, в одном файле исходная матрица хранится, а в другой результат нужно записать.
eoln вне форума Ответить с цитированием
Старый 21.12.2016, 11:36   #6
Meksvinz
 
Регистрация: 05.11.2016
Сообщений: 7
По умолчанию

Цитата:
Сообщение от p51x Посмотреть сообщение
Еще раз fopen не поток, это просто функция. Фиг с этим... Что вы от файлов то хотите в этой задаче?

В чем проблема с задачей? Тупо в лоб: рассматриваем матрицу по столбцам и получаем на каждом шаге одномерный массив, который надо циклически сдвинуть.
С пониманием задачи проблем нет. Я не могу понять с чего начать.
Создаём двумерный массив, записываем его в файл и... Всё, на этом я застопорился. Вроде нужно какие-то операции с указателем в файле делать. Мне бы какие-то функции для работы с указателем и их применение и тогда бы вопрос сошел на "нет"
Meksvinz вне форума Ответить с цитированием
Старый 21.12.2016, 11:49   #7
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,833
По умолчанию

1. Вы так и не объяснили зачем вам файлы в этой задаче. Ну допустим eoln прав.
2.
Цитата:
Создаём двумерный массив, записываем его в файл и... Всё, на этом я застопорился.
Хорошо, значит входные данные у вас уже есть
3.
Цитата:
Вроде нужно какие-то операции с указателем в файле делать.
Зачем? Вы о чем? Теперь ваша первоочередная задача - это считать записанный массив обратно.
4. См. предыдущий пост...
p51x в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Осуществить циклический сдвиг элементов квадратной матрицы ( Паскаль ) Челобег Помощь студентам 0 03.04.2016 14:36
ЦИКЛИЧЕСКИЙ СДВИГ ЭЛЕМЕНТОВ КВАДРАТНОЙ МАТРИЦЫ kreiver Помощь студентам 6 04.03.2014 18:50
C++.циклический сдвиг элементов квадратной матрицы arsalan Помощь студентам 1 11.05.2010 08:08
C++|Циклический сдвиг матрицы|Шаблоны|Перегрузка Troi666 Помощь студентам 2 01.05.2009 14:46
Циклический сдвиг строки матрицы Alex1991 Помощь студентам 1 14.04.2009 21:20